6.3 Pitau (Koru)
Up one level6The Māori Trade Marks Advisory Committee has advised the Commissioner that where a pitau (also known as koru) appears as a device in a trade mark, it does not consider such devices to be offensive for a wide range of goods and services.
As a result, the Commissioner will not send marks incorporating pitau to the Committee, unless:
- the application contains an association with genetic technologies;
- the application includes other Maori text and/or imagery; or
- the Commissioner considers that the application may be offensive in relation to particular goods and services.
